What We Learnt At E3
- Voice actor Kevin Conroy, who voices Batman, says Batman: Arkham Knight will be released in January.
- Vehicles will be included for the first time in an Arkham series game – so far we’ve seen the batmobile and bat tank.
- Hands-on reports suggest the batmobile is exceptionally fun to drive around Gotham in.
- There’s a Battle Mode in Batman: Arkham Knight.
- The batmobile can be controlled remotely, meaning you can drive it around an entirely different part of the world than Batman is located at the time.
- Batman can also launch himself into the air and glide, straight from the batmobile.
- Scarecrow is back as one of the villains in Batman: Arkham Knight, also confirmed for the game so far are The Penguin, Two-Face and The Riddler.
- This will be the last game in the Arkham series developed by Rocksteady.
